Acadia University
Acadia University is a non-profit university located in Wolfville, Nova Scotia, officially recognized by the Department of Labour and Advanced Education, Nova Scotia.
About Acadia University
- Name: Acadia University
- Acronym: AU
- Founded: 1838
- Motto: In pulvere vinces (In dust, you conquer)
- Colors: Garnet and Blue
